Charity
Murcer was involved with many charities, including serving as the chairman of the board of the Baseball Assistance Team (BAT), which grants money to former players and other baseball figures who are in need, and holding an annual golf tournament which has raised more than $1 million for the American Cancer Society since 1990. In 1995, he joined with fellow Oklahoman Mickey Mantle to raise money for the victims of the Alfred P. Murrah Federal Building bombing. He also appeared in celebrity rodeos for various charitable organizations showing his skills in riding horses and roping.
